ABOUT CA COURSE:
CA FOUNDATION COURSE
Foundation Course is the entry level for Chartered Accountancy Course.
Eligibility
Students after passing class Xth examination can register for Foundation Course.
Students can appear in the Foundation Examination –
(i) After appearing in the senior secondary (10+2) examination
(ii) After completing 4 months’ study period from the date of registration in order to be eligible to appear in the Foundation Examination. Students registered on or before 1st January / 1st July will be eligible to appear in May/November examination every year, as the case may be.
Foundation Examinations are held twice a year in the months of May and November.
Subjects covered in Foundation Course
Paper-1: Principles and Practice of Accounting (100 Marks)
Paper-2: Business Law & Business Correspondence and Reporting (100 Marks)
Section A: Business Law (60 Marks)
Section B: Business Correspondence and Reporting (40 Marks)
Paper-3: Business Mathematics and Logical Reasoning & Statistics (100 Marks)
Part I: Business Mathematics and Logical Reasoning (60 Marks)
Part II: Statistics (40 Marks)
Paper-4: Business Economics & Business and Commercial Knowledge (100 Marks)
Part I: Business Economics (60 Marks)
Part II: Business and Commercial Knowledge (40 Marks)
Paper-3 and Paper-4 are objective type papers with negative marking.
Passing criteria in Foundation Examination
A Foundation Course candidate shall be declared to have passed the examination if he/ she obtains at one sitting a minimum of 40% marks in each paper and a minimum of 50% marks in aggregate of all the papers, subject to the principle of negative marking.
CA INTERMEDIATE
Students of Intermediate Course, who have registered through Foundation Course route or Intermediate level examination passed students of The Institute of Cost Accountants of India or The Institute of Company Secretaries of India, are required to undergo eight months study course before appearing for the first time in the Intermediate Examination.
Candidates who are Graduates/ Post Graduates in Commerce 55% of the total marks or other than those falling under Commerce stream having secured in aggregate a minimum of 60% of the total marks are eligible for straight away registration to Intermediate Course and undergo ICITSS. They can register for practical training after completing ICITSS they are eligible to appear in the Intermediate Examination after completion of nine months of practical training.
Students who are pursuing the Final year Graduation Course can also register for the Intermediate Course on provisional basis.
Subjects covered in Intermediate Course
Group I
Paper-1: Accounting (100 Marks)
Paper-2: Corporate and Other Laws (100 Marks)
Part I: Company Law (60 Marks)
Part II: Other Laws (40 Marks)
Paper-3: Cost and Management Accounting (100 Marks)
Paper-4: Taxation (100 Marks)
Section A: Income-Tax Law (60 Marks)
Section B: Indirect Taxes (40 Marks)
Group II
Paper-5: Advanced Accounting (100 Marks)
Paper-6: Auditing and Assurance (100 Marks)
Paper-7: Enterprise Information Systems & Strategic Management (100 Marks)
Section A: Enterprise Information Systems (50 Marks)
Section B: Strategic Management (50 Marks)
Paper-8: Financial Management & Economics for Finance (100 Marks)
Section A: Financial Management (60 Marks)
Section B: Economics for Finance (40 Marks)
CA FINAL
Students after qualifying both the groups of Intermediate Examination are eligible to register for Final Course and would be allowed to appear in Final Examination during last six months of practical training after successful completion of Four Weeks Advanced Integrated Course on Information Technology and Soft Skills (AICITSS).
Subjects covered in Final Course
Group I
Paper-1: Financial Reporting (100 Marks)
Paper-2: Strategic Financial Management (100 Marks)
Paper-3: Advanced Auditing and Professional Ethics (100 Marks)
Paper-4: Corporate and Economic Laws (100 Marks)
Part I: Corporate Laws (70 Marks)
Part II: Economic Laws (30 Marks)
Group II
Paper-5: Strategic Cost Management and Performance Evaluation (100 Marks)
Paper-6: Elective Paper (100 Marks) (One to be chosen from the list of Elective Papers)
Elective Papers
- 6A Risk Management
- 6B Financial Services & Capital Markets
- 6C International Taxation
- 6D Economic Laws
- 6E Global Financial Reporting Standards
- 6F Multi-Disciplinary Case Study
Paper-7: Direct Tax Laws & International Taxation (100 Marks)
Part I: Direct Tax Laws (70 Marks)
Part II: International Taxation (30 Marks)
Paper-8: Indirect Tax Laws (100 Marks)
Part I: Goods and Service Tax (75 Marks)
Part II: Customs & FTP (25 Marks)
The subjects of Final Course are classified into two groups which a student can study and appear in the examination group-wise or both the groups together.
CA FOUNDATION COURSE
Students after passing class Xth examination can register for Foundation Course.
Registration Fee
S.NO | DETAILS OF FEES | Rs. |
---|---|---|
1 | Cost of Foundation Prospectus | 200 |
2 | Foundation Registration fee | 9,000 |
3 | Subscription for Students’ Journal (For One Year) (Optional) | 200 |
4 | Subscription for Members’ Journal (For One Year) (Optional) | 400 |
CA INTERMEDIATE COURSE
Candidates through Foundation Route can opt for registration for Group I or Group II or Both Groups of Intermediate Course while Direct Entry Route candidates have to register for both the groups only.
Registration Fee
Registration Options/ Various Charges Both Groups | Both Groups | Group I/ II |
---|---|---|
Registration Fee | 15,000 | 11,000 |
Students’ Activities Fee | 2,000 | 2,000 |
Registration Fee as Articled Assistant | 1,000 | |
Total Fee | 18,000 | 13,000 |
CA FINAL COURSE
Registration Fee
An eligible student shall register for Final Course on payment of Rs.22, 000.
Articleship Training / Audit Training (3 YEARS)
The unique requirement of practical training is instrumental in shaping a well-rounded professional to ensure that students have an opportunity to acquire on-the-job work experience of a professional nature.

Four Weeks Advanced Integrated Course on Information Technology and Soft Skills (AICITSS)
Course on Advanced Information Technology (AICITSS)
Eligibility
As a part of the New Scheme of Four Weeks Advanced Integrated Course on Information Technology Training and Soft Skills (AICITSS) for Chartered Accountancy Course, a student undergoing practical training shall be required to do AICITSS during the last 2 years of practical training but to complete the same before being eligible to appear in the Final Examination.
Duration
The classes are scheduled for minimum 6 hours per day, in 15 working days.
Fees
The fee shall be Rs. 7500 (Seven Thousand Five Hundred only) per student on non-residential basis, inclusive of course material and tea/refreshment.
AICITSS (MCS Course)
The student registered under the revised scheme or converted under the Revised scheme shall be undergoing the course during the last two years of Practical training but compulsory before appearing for the final examination.
Duration
The duration of the course is 15 days’ full time.
Fees
The fees shall not exceed Rs.7000/- per student on non-residential basis inclusive of course, study material, tea/refreshment.
